Undergraduate Tuition & Fees
The following table compares 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average undergraduate tuition & fees is $6,854 for in-state students and $14,583 for out-of-state students. The 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 2.75%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, Washington State University-Tri Cities requires the most expensive tuition & fees of $28,008 and North Seattle College has the lowest tuition & fees of $5,547 for undergraduate programs.
Name | 2022-2023 | 2023-2024 | ||
---|---|---|---|---|
In-State | Out-of-State | In-State | Out-of-State | |
Washington State University-Tri Cities | $11,664 | $27,348 | $11,932 | $28,008 |
Central Washington University | $8,845 | $25,910 | $9,192 | $26,771 |
Clark College | $4,529 | $10,133 | $4,632 | $10,380 |
North Seattle College | $5,058 | $5,547 | $5,058 | $5,547 |
Whatcom Community College | $4,982 | $10,731 | $5,146 | $11,096 |
Yakima Valley College | $4,998 | $5,488 | $5,163 | $5,697 |
Average | $6,679 | $14,193 | $6,854 | $14,583 |
